Philippine National Police Chief Debold Sinas said that rattan sticks or ‘yantok’ will not be used to hit quarantine and social distancing violators.

Sinas said that the sticks will only be used to measure the distance between people amid the coronavirus pandemic.

“Ini-encourage namin at dina-direct ‘yung mga pulis to pinpoint na ‘Ma’am social distancing tayo, ganito…’ para medyo mahaba. Yantok po ang available kasi naubos na ‘yung mga baton natin. Makita mo ‘yung baton, maiksi lang ‘yun. We prefer a longer one, which is yantok,” Sinas said.

The PNP Chief however said that sticks may be used to those who will be resisting arrest.

“Hindi po ‘yun gagamitin sa pamamalo o pagganon-ganon… also kaya naman kami nagkuwan, pag may mga bayolente at nagreresist, instead na barilin kaagad namin, ‘yun na lang pangsubdue namin,” Sinas added.

Malacañang does not recommend the use of ‘yantok’ in enforcing social distancing measures. (TDT)
